Erin has quarters and nickels for a total of 16 coins. The value of his coins is $2.60. Let represent the number of quarters and
Aneli [31]

Note: Consider we need to find each type of coins he has.

Given:

Erin has quarters and nickels for a total of 16 coins.

The value of his coins is $2.60.

To find:

The number of each type of coins.

Solution:

Let x represent the number of quarters and y represent the number of nickels.

According to the question,

Total coins : x+y=16        ...(i)​

Total value : 0.25x+0.05y=2.60        ...(ii)​

Multiply equation (i) by 0.25 and subtract the result from (ii).

0.25x+0.05y-0.25(x+y)=2.60-0.25(16)

0.25x+0.05y-0.25x-0.25y=2.60-4

-0.20y=-1.40

Divide both sides by -0.20.

y=7

Put y=7 in (i).

x+7=16

x=16-7

x=9

Therefore, the number of quarters is 9 and number of nickels is 7.

Sarah is selling bracelets and earrings to make money for summer vacation. The bracelets cost $2 and the earrings cost $3. She n
vivado [14]

Sarah is selling bracelets. The inequalities are a > 10 and 2a + 3b ≥ 60.

<u>Solution:</u>

Given, Sarah is selling bracelets and earrings to make money for summer vacation.  

bracelets cost = $2

earrings cost = $3  

She needs to make at least $60.  

Sarah knows she will sell more than 10 bracelets.  

We have to write inequalities

Now, according to given information,  

Total money ≥ $ 60

Money earned from bracelets + money earned by earrings ≥ 60

2 x number of bracelets + 3 x number of earrings ≥ 60

2a + 3b ≥ 60  

[ where a is number of bracelets and b is number of earrings]

And, number of bracelets is more than 10 ⇒ a > 10

Hence, the inequalities are a > 10 and 2a + 3b ≥ 60
